    Pros:
    - Awesome 32-bit era graphics.
    - Good music.

    Cons:
    - Controls...Jesus, how would I descibe it. It's like most of beat'em ups, yet imagine that your up and down buttons on the D-pad are broken and you can only move back to the background and to your initial position. Switching between these 'lines' takes way too much dynamics from the game and slows it down quite a bit. What's more, it is very diificult to maneurve when there're a lot of enemies (sometimes on nightmare+ it maybe even be impossible to evade their attacks)Secondly, who the **** thought, that having UP as a jump button is a ******* great idea!? Jet let me punch that person in his ugly face.
    - Although music in this game is really good, I feel that it suits Castlevania type of games much more.
    - Leveling up, which isn't that necessary, so why even bother putting it in this game? To make you feel that you've accomplished something?
    - The storyline...it's just there.
    - Voice acting...please, somebody, kill me already, I can't hear it no more. Play the arcade mode to avoid this nuisance.

    Verdict:
    Mediocre.
    That graphics, man...it saved the game for me.
